Are Mercedes-Benz repair services more expensive in Crooks, SD, compared to non-luxury brands?

Yes, servicing a Mercedes-Benz in Crooks typically carries a higher cost due to specialized parts, advanced diagnostic equipment, and technician training required. However, independent shops specializing in European cars often provide more competitive labor rates than dealerships, which are located further away in Sioux Falls.

What are the most common Mercedes-Benz repair issues for drivers in the Crooks climate?

Given South Dakota's cold winters and road salt use, common issues include premature wear on suspension components like air struts and corrosion on brake lines. Battery failures are also frequent due to extreme cold and the high electrical demand of Mercedes-Benz's advanced systems.

When should I seek local service versus going to the Mercedes-Benz dealership in Sioux Falls?

For routine maintenance (oil changes, brake service) and many common repairs, a qualified independent shop in Crooks or nearby Sioux Falls can provide excellent service. For complex computer/electrical issues or warranty work, the authorized dealership in Sioux Falls may be necessary for specific proprietary software and tools.

How can I find a quality independent repair shop for my Mercedes near Crooks?

Look for shops in the Sioux Falls area that explicitly advertise as European or Mercedes-Benz specialists, with ASE or manufacturer-specific certified technicians. Check online reviews and ask for referrals from other local Mercedes owners, as word-of-mouth is valuable in our community.

Are there any local driving conditions near Crooks that specifically affect my Mercedes-Benz?

Yes, the combination of rural gravel roads, frequent freeze-thaw cycles creating potholes, and long highway drives can be tough on suspension and alignment. It's advisable to have your suspension and tire integrity checked regularly by a shop familiar with these conditions and your vehicle's specific design.
